# California AB 2119 (20172018) — Foster care: gender affirming health care and mental health care.
Existing law provides that it is the policy of the state that all minors and nonminors in foster care have specified rights, including, among others, the right to receive medical, dental, vision, and mental health services, the right to be involved in the development of their own case plans and plans for permanent placement, and the right to be placed in out-of-home care according to their gender identity, regardless of the gender or sex listed in their court or child welfare records.

## Timeline
The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.
- **2018-02-08** Read first time. To print. `reading-1`
- **2018-02-09** From printer. May be heard in committee March 11.
- **2018-02-22** Referred to Com. on HUM. S. `referral-committee`
- **2018-03-20** In committee: Hearing postponed by committee.
- **2018-04-04** From committee chair, with author's amendments: Amend, and re-refer to Com. on HUM. S. Read second time and amended. `amendment-introduction, amendment-passage, reading-2, reading-1`
- **2018-04-05** Re-referred to Com. on HUM. S. `referral-committee`
- **2018-04-11** From committee: Do pass and re-refer to Com. on APPR. (Ayes 5. Noes 1.) (April 10). Re-referred to Com. on APPR. `committee-passage-favorable, committee-passage, referral-committee`
- **2018-05-02** In committee: Hearing postponed by committee.
- **2018-05-09** From committee: Do pass. (Ayes 11. Noes 5.) (May 9). `committee-passage-favorable, committee-passage`
- **2018-05-10** Read second time. Ordered to third reading. `reading-2, reading-1`
- **2018-05-21** Read third time. Passed. Ordered to the Senate. (Ayes 46. Noes 22. Page 5241.) `reading-3, passage, reading-1`
- **2018-05-22** In Senate. Read first time. To Com. on RLS. for assignment. `reading-1`
- **2018-05-30** Referred to Coms. on HUMAN S. and JUD. `referral-committee`
- **2018-06-13** From committee: Do pass and re-refer to Com. on JUD. (Ayes 5. Noes 0.) (June 12). Re-referred to Com. on JUD. `committee-passage-favorable, committee-passage, referral-committee`
- **2018-06-18** From committee chair, with author's amendments: Amend, and re-refer to committee. Read second time, amended, and re-referred to Com. on JUD. `amendment-passage, referral-committee, reading-2, reading-1, amendment-introduction`
- **2018-06-27** From committee: Do pass and re-refer to Com. on APPR. (Ayes 5. Noes 2.) (June 26). Re-referred to Com. on APPR. `committee-passage-favorable, committee-passage, referral-committee`
- **2018-08-06** From committee chair, with author's amendments: Amend, and re-refer to committee. Read second time, amended, and re-referred to Com. on APPR. `amendment-passage, referral-committee, reading-2, reading-1, amendment-introduction`
- **2018-08-06** In committee: Hearing postponed by committee.
- **2018-08-13** From committee: Be ordered to second reading pursuant to Senate Rule 28.8. `committee-passage, reading-2`
- **2018-08-14** Read second time. Ordered to third reading. `reading-2, reading-1`
- **2018-08-20** Read third time and amended. Ordered to second reading. `amendment-passage, reading-3, reading-1`
- **2018-08-21** Read second time. Ordered to third reading. `reading-2, reading-1`
- **2018-08-27** Read third time. Passed. Ordered to the Assembly. (Ayes 26. Noes 12. Page 5806.). `reading-3, passage, reading-1`
- **2018-08-27** In Assembly. Concurrence in Senate amendments pending. May be considered on or after August 29 pursuant to Assembly Rule 77.
- **2018-08-29** Senate amendments concurred in. To Engrossing and Enrolling. (Ayes 53. Noes 22. Page 6837.). `committee-passage-favorable, amendment-passage`
- **2018-09-06** Enrolled and presented to the Governor at 3 p.m.
- **2018-09-14** Approved by the Governor. `executive-signature`
- **2018-09-14** Chaptered by Secretary of State - Chapter 385, Statutes of 2018.
